Ingredients for Kashmiri Chicken:
- Chicken – 8 big pieces
- Kashmiri chilli powder – 4 big spoons
Tomato ketchup – 4 big spoons
Soya sauce – 1 big spoon
Vinegar – 1 small spoon
Garam masala powder – 1 small spoon
Salt – For taste
Sugar – 1 small spoon - Oil – 3 big spoons
- Ginger crushed – 2 pieces
Garlic crushed – 4 cloves
Lemon juice – 1 big spoon - Coriander leaves chopped – 1 big spoon
How to prepare Kashmiri Chicken?
- Mix together ingredients no: 2 and make a fine paste.
- Marinate chicken pieces using this paste and keep in the freezer for 2 hours.
- After that, take it out and place it outside for some time.
- Heat oil in a big pan, and sauté garlic and half the quantity of ginger.
- Add marinated chicken and fry both sides.
- Close the pan with a lid and cook till chicken turns soft.
- Later, add lemon juice, remaining ginger and coriander leaves.
- Serve hot with fried rice.
